### Runbook: Account Recovery — Monthly Partition Store

When a Fenwick Ledger operator account is locked, recovery requires read access to the `events_YYYYMM` partitions. Attach to the maintenance replica, confirm the current month's partition is mounted, and run the unlock job from the tooling host. The job prompts once; supply the recovery passphrase shown below.

vault phrase of tajef-tafog = istox-sorax-zorox-casok-holox-kelix-weneth-drueth-casion

### Tidemark Widget — Onboarding Note

For this week's sync: the tide-table widget now pulls predictions from the Saltgrove forecast service, cached hourly, with graceful fallback to the last known table on outage. Releases are built, verified, and signed in one pipeline stage. The widget's release signing key appears below.

deploy key for kajof-fajop: bky6_gDHw9Q

## Runbook: Retrying Failed Exports (Corvetta Reports)

If a Corvetta export fails, check the job status page first. Status `STALLED` — retry once via the Retry button. Status `REJECTED` — do not retry; escalate to the data desk. Retries are safe; exports are idempotent. Wait 5 minutes between attempts. If three retries fail, capture the export ID and the worker build before escalating. The ticket will be bounced without both. The worker build token appears below.

trace token, fafog-kageg: htk4_98e6

This page summarises current pricing for the Merrowline series ahead of the annual review. The base tier remains margin-healthy, but the mid-tier Merrowline Plus has drifted below our 38% target following last year's input cost increases from Caldew Polymers. Finance proposes a staged 4% uplift across the Plus and Pro tiers, phased over two quarters to limit churn among long-standing accounts managed out of the Fenwick office. Heads of department should review before Thursday's session. The confidential rationale follows below.

confidential, kagep-kahof: Druokax Systems plans to lower the Ulaath list price by 53 percent in March.